SWEET-SOUR MEATBALLS FOR THE CROCKETTE

This recipe is adapted from the fall 2006 edition of Cooking for 2. It is prepared in a crockette or 1 1/2 qt crockpot and makes a deliciously quick meal for a small family.

Time 5h15m

Yield 3 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

12 -16 fully cooked frozen meatballs, thawed
1/4 cup brown sugar, packed
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/3 cup white wine vinegar
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1/2 medium green pepper, cut into 1 inch chunks
1/2 medium white onion, cut into 1 inch chunks
1 (8 ounce) can pineapple chunks, undrained
hot cooked rice

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the sugar, cornstarch, vinegar and soy sauce.
  • Place the thawed meatballs in the slow cooker and pour the prepared sauce over, stirring to coat.
  • Add the green pepper and onions, cover and cook for 4 to 5 hours.
  • The last 30 minutes of cooking, stir in the pineapple.
  • Stir and serve over the hot cooked rice.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 150.1, Fat 0.1, Sodium 344.7, Carbohydrate 37.7, Fiber 1.3, Sugar 29.9, Protein 1.3
